Italy coach Roberto Mancini has signed a new deal to 2026.
FIGC President Gabriele Gravina has announced Mancini will lead Italy at the next two European Championships and two World Cups.
“We wanted to give continuity to our work," Gravina said at the Federal Council. “Beyond winning a trophy, there's a project to work on.
“Mancini has been working brilliantly for two years and moving forward on this project was a duty out of respect for the Federation and our fans.
“We made an important choice, supported by us in the Federation and not by different sponsors or other parties.
“We want to caress the enthusiasm of the Italian fans, now we are aiming to win a trophy that has been missing for years and we must put ourselves forward.
“Without overthinking if it doesn't happen, because only one team wins in the end."
